An infrastructure based on multiple heterogeneous access networks is one of the leading enablers for the emerging pervasive and ubiquitous computing paradigm, in which the optimal management of diverse networking resources is a challenging problem. This paper presents a context-aware policy mechanism and related end-to-end evaluation algorithm for adaptive connectivity management of multi-access wireless networks. A policy is used to express the criteria for adaptive selection of the best local and remote network interfaces. The best connection can then be used for the establishment of a channel as well as the maintenance of on-going data transmission. Rich context information is considered in the policy representation with respect to user profile and preference, application characteristics, device capability, and network QoS condition.
